About The Position

A healthcare facility in Falmouth, MA is seeking a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N / LVN) for a contract assignment. The LPN will provide direct nursing care to residents while supervising the daily activities of nursing assistants. The role requires maintaining high standards of resident care while 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local regulations governing long-term care facilities.

Requirements

  • Active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N / LVN) License – Massachusetts
  • Minimum 1 year of nursing experience in a hospital or clinical setting
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ification through the American Heart Association
  • Ability to work rotating shifts, weekends, and holidays
  • Strong clinical assessment and documentation skills
  • Excellent communication and teamwork abilities
  • Commitment to maintaining high standards of resident care and safety

Responsibilities

  • Provide direct patient care and supervise nursing assistants during daily clinical activities
  • Plan and coordinate shift activities, services, and resident care programs
  • Complete required documentation for resident admission, transfer, and discharge
  • Record and transcribe physician orders, treatment plans, and medication instructions
  • Maintain accurate nursing notes and clinical documentation reflecting patient care and responses
  • Prepare and administer medications and treatments as prescribed by physicians
  • Perform clinical procedures such as: Catheterization Tube feedings Suctioning Wound care and dressing changes Colostomy and drainage care Range of motion exercises
  • Collect patient specimens including blood, urine, and sputum for laboratory testing
  • Monitor and record vital signs including temperature, pulse, respiration, and blood pressure
  • Ensure adequate medical supplies, medications, and equipment are available for resident care
  • Collaborate with physicians and interdisciplinary teams regarding treatment and care plans
  • Provide health education to residents and family members regarding care and treatment plans
  • Maintain strict patient confidentiality and compliance with healthcare privacy regulations
